run time exception on init-snmp in VC++

Hi,

I have compiled the tutorial sample application with
V1 under MicroSoft Visual Studio C++ 6.0 compiler.
With the following settings:
- MultiThreaded DLL for the application.
- Library directory pointing to
win32/lib/release/netsnmp.lib
- Manually have copied over the
win32/lib/release/netsnmp.lib into the same directory
as my test application executable

It compiles and links with no error.

But when I run it, I get Application Error:
The instruction at "0x7801240c" referenced memory at
"0x77ff9000". The memory could not be "read".

I appreciate if any one can help?

Also, my plan is to figure out how to compile and run
using the C++ and then figure out how to compile and
run in Visual Basic.

Are there any code available for VB?
